Photo analysis (animal identification, weight, and condition) runs on AgriForge's own servers and is not sent to a third-party AI provider.

AgriForge will notify Customer of changes to Sub-processors by email or in-app at least 30 days before a new Sub-processor begins processing Personal Information, during which Customer may object on reasonable data-protection grounds.

8. Security incidents

AgriForge will notify Customer without undue delay after becoming aware of a breach of security safeguards involving Personal Information processed on Customer's behalf, and will provide information reasonably available to help Customer meet its own notification obligations (including, under PIPEDA, assessing real risk of significant harm), targeting notification within 72 hours of confirming the incident.


9. Return and deletion

On termination of the Service, or on Customer's request, AgriForge will delete or return Personal Information processed on Customer's behalf, except where retention is required by law, within 90 days. Backups are deleted on a rolling cycle.
